Dad's Famous Strogonoff

Ingredients

2 pounds of beef for stew
1 medium onion
garlic (fresh 7 to 8 cloves/ minced in the jar 1 large tablespoon)
olive oil
vegetable oil
all purpose flour
Tabasco sauce
garlic salt
black pepper
crushed red peppers
sliced mushrooms
1 8oz container of sour cream
1 bottle of beer (any kind)
1 1/2 bottle of water
3 beef bouillon cubes
1 large bag of extra wide egg noodles

Directions

Peel and dice the onion. In a large frying pan pour olive oil just enough to cover bottom of the pan, saute' the onion in olive oil on a medium heat. Before the onions caramelize, add the garlic. If you use fresh garlic/ use a garlic press to mince garlic.If you use minced garlic in a jar(which you can get a large jar that will last forever from Costco) use one large tablespoon. Stir garlic with the onion, make sure not to step away since the garlic cooks fast. Cook for two minutes or until starts to turn golden brown.

Add in the beef for stew. Cook beef untill completely brown. Add black pepper, garlic salt, crushed red peppers. Stir. Then add one package of sliced mushrooms ( you can use two small cans of sliced mushrooms if you like, fresh is better though) Cook another 5 minutes, while stiring occasionally.

Add one bottle of beer 12 oz (any kind will do). After pouring in beer, fill bottle with water and add 1 1/2 bottle of water to the broth.

Now add three cubes of beef bouillons to mixture. Add three splashes of Tabasco sauce as well.

Cook with a rapid simmer/ uncovered for 20 to 25 minutes. Stir occasionally.

In a regular coffee cup add vegetable oil to slighly less than half the cup / slowly add flour while stirring with a fork. Stir after each scoop making sure you have NO LUMPS Add flour until thickens to thick syrup consistancy. This is going to go in to thicken the strogonoff.

Reduce heat to slow simmer.

Pour half of flour/ oil mixture to the broth.Thoroughly stir into broth. Add more as needed. You don't want the strogonoff too thin at this point because when you add the sour cream it is going to thin it out.

Finally add 8oz container of sour cream. Stir in sour cream until completely mixed into strogonoff.

In a separate pot, boil water for extra wide egg noodles, add salt as desired. Cook noodels for 10 to 15 minutes. Drain.

Serve strogonoff over noodles.

Suggested to serve fresh slices bread on the side.

North Mountian/ Shaw Butte



At the top of North Mountain. Rating: Easy. Time: about an hour.

Location: 7th Street & Thunderbird


The parking lot for Shaw Butte is at Central & Thunderbird. Get there early because it is a small parking lot and they WILL tow your car if you park in the neighborhood area...

Rating: Intermediate due to some steep areas

Time: 1 or 1 1/2 hours.
